The Soave-Redlich-Kwong (SRK) equation of state was used to
investigate and develop several aspects of the modeling of natural
petroleum fluids.A new method was presented for numerical
evaluation of PVT experiments. This method was used in the
estimation of binary interaction parameters. A comphrensive study
of pseudoization procedures is presented. It is concluded that the
compared methods exhibit results of comparable accuracy, and that
six to eight pseudocomponents are needed for optimal
representation of petroleum fluids.Finally, it is investigated how
well the EOS can represent the VLLE that exists for mixtures of
CO2 and crude oils. Good results are obtained, and a tuning
procedure is proposed for improved representation of the three
phase equilibria.
